Summary
Notes and collations, in Latin and Greek, of Greek MSS. of the Old Testament (fols. 1, 126), Irenaeus (fols. 93, 158), Epiphanius (fol. 90), Athanasius (fol. 146), etc., made by or for dr. Grabe, but apparently in a fragmentary state.
Date
Written about A.D. 1700 chiefly by J. E. Grabe
